One of the most important roles ants play in ecosystems is their contribution to soil health. As ants dig their intricate underground tunnels, they aerate the soil, allowing oxygen and water to penetrate deeper. This process improves soil structure and promotes the growth of plants by enhancing root access to essential nutrients.
Additionally, ants transport organic matter, such as leaves and dead insects, into their nests. Over time, this material decomposes, enriching the soil with nutrients. In fact, studies have shown that areas with high ant activity often have more fertile soil, which benefits surrounding plant life.
Ants are natural predators of many agricultural pests, making them an essential part of integrated pest management. Species like the red imported fire ant and weaver ants are known to prey on harmful insects such as caterpillars, aphids, and termites. By keeping pest populations in check, ants help reduce the need for chemical pesticides, which can have harmful effects on the environment.
Farmers in some regions even use ants as a natural pest control solution. For example, in parts of Africa and Asia, weaver ants are introduced into orchards to protect crops like mangoes and cashews from destructive pests. This symbiotic relationship highlights the value of ants in sustainable agriculture.
Ants also play a crucial role in seed dispersal, a process known as myrmecochory. Certain plants produce seeds with nutrient-rich appendages called elaiosomes, which attract ants. The ants carry these seeds back to their nests, where they consume the elaiosomes and discard the seeds in nutrient-rich soil. This not only helps plants spread to new areas but also increases their chances of successful germination.
Some plants, such as bloodroot and trillium, rely almost exclusively on ants for seed dispersal. Without these industrious insects, the survival and distribution of these plant species would be at risk.
Ants are nature’s cleanup crew. As scavengers, they play a critical role in breaking down organic matter, including dead animals and decaying plant material. By consuming and recycling this matter, ants help prevent the buildup of waste in ecosystems and contribute to nutrient cycling.
For example, army ants are known for their ability to quickly clean up carcasses, leaving behind only bones. This behavior not only benefits the environment but also helps control the spread of disease by removing potential breeding grounds for harmful bacteria and parasites.
Ants themselves are an important food source for many animals, including birds, reptiles, and mammals. Their abundance and high protein content make them a valuable part of the food chain. In some cultures, ants are even consumed by humans as a sustainable source of protein.
By serving as both predators and prey, ants occupy a unique position in the food web, helping to maintain ecological balance.
Despite their ecological importance, ants face numerous threats, including habitat destruction, climate change, and pesticide use. Deforestation and urbanization disrupt their habitats, while rising temperatures can alter their behavior and distribution. Additionally, the widespread use of chemical pesticides can harm ant populations, reducing their ability to perform essential ecosystem services.
Protecting ant habitats and promoting sustainable practices are crucial steps in ensuring these tiny but mighty creatures continue to thrive.
